Assessment Details

Did you do an international year long placement as part of your degree?

Please note that if you are completing or have completed an international year long placement and are receiving the Diploma in Professional Practice (International) then your placement will automatically count towards your EDGE Award. The relevant EDGE activity will show on your EDGE record around November/December of your final year. You do not need to provide additional evidence for the purposes of EDGE.

Evidence for EDGE Award accreditation (programmes that do not count as your year long placement)

If you completed any of the following programmes please provide evidence of completion and email this evidence to careers@ulster.ac.uk. Evidence can be email confirmation from the relevant organisation or an official certificate of completion. Evidence must be provided within the same year that you completed the programme.
